Output 3da95da7dfade0b58ed99d9634178267eefec8f3e48cf35469d18d7e53caf428:0

value
575100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1131dd83f2c1a77c132b9cb6166093e21700eb10 OP_EQUAL
address
33Fw9WKPFZSfoAoiixRVGbJXf8UzRGBhqm
transaction
3da95da7dfade0b58ed99d9634178267eefec8f3e48cf35469d18d7e53caf428